Anna R. Mills, a college English instructor from California, reflects on her experience of testing the ChatGPT 4 updates in the Chronicle for Higher Education. While observing the improved capacity of the AI generator, she also warns that the instructional methods used to deter and detect student use of AI for writing may not work as AI further develops. Mills also provides solutions for instructors to implement in their college classes that center on focusing on motivation, emphasizing the value of the writing process itself, and explaining the significant impact writing has on student learning.
